.trans-wrap .output-wrap{width:100%;padding:10px;}.trans-wrap .input-wrap{border:1px solid #dcdcdc;}.trans-wrap .input-wrap>textarea{resize:none;height:130px;min-height:100%;font-size:22px;display:inline-block;
以element-ui的input组件举例,当我们在组件内输入值时,会调用resizeTextarea方法 resizeTextarea() {if(this.$isServer)return;const{ autosize, type } =this;if(type !=='textarea')return;if(!autosize) {this.textareaCalcStyle = { minHeight: calcTextareaHeight(this.$refs.textarea).minHeight };...
clearKeywords () {this.keywords='';this.list= [];lettextarea =this.$refs.textarea;letheight =40;letrem = height / rootFontSize; textarea.style.height=`${rem}rem`; rem = (height +20) / rootFontSize;this.$refs.list.style.height=`calc(100% -${rem}rem)`; textarea.focus(); },...
【摘要】 项目开发过程中,在展示用户录入意见信息时,使用el-input标签,type=”textarea”属性,在指定:row=”number”后,若输入文本量或显示文本量超过指定行数后,会出现垂直滚动条,但在IE环境下,该滚动条是隐藏的,用户体验性不好,故考虑实现文本框根据文本内容自适应高度的效果。应用代码如下: <template> <div ...
项目开发过程中,在展示用户录入意见信息时,使用el-input标签,type=”textarea”属性,在指定:row=”number”后,若输入文本量或显示文本量超过指定行数后,会出现垂直滚动条,但在IE环境下,该滚动条是隐藏的,用户体验性不好,故考虑实现文本框根据文本内容自适应高度的效果。应用代码如下: ...
我正在使用autosize插件(但不介意其他选择),我需要调整加载的textarea的大小,它还应该在键入时自动调整大小(就像autosize.js允许您做的那样)。我没有在它的网页上找到这样的信息,在我的文本区域加载之后,我尝试了$(el).trigger('autosize.resize')和autosize.update($(el)),但是都没有工作。
常见得⽅案有两种,⼀种是在页⾯地“边远地区”添加⼀个ghost dom来模拟输⼊换⾏,这个dom的可能是editable属性为true的div或者是⼀个⼀摸⼀样得textarea。以element-ui的input组件举例,当我们在组件内输⼊值时,会调⽤resizeTextarea⽅法 resizeTextarea() { if (this.$isServer) return;...
this.$nextTick(this.resizeTextarea); } 1: 判断是不是 autosize自动高度, 并且是组件autosize 2: 用户是否设置了最大高度与最小高度的限制 3: 这个函数只负责处理是否进行计算 calcTextareaHeight 负责计算. resizeTextarea() { const { autosize, type } = this; ...
点击按钮,使textarea,的resize属性,在none和vertical之间动态切换 在已有的数组里追加数据,不行 <template> <div> <helloTest></helloTest> <ul> <li v-for="item in data" :key="item.id"> {{item.id}}--{{item.name}}--{{item.show}} <button @click="aa(item)">aa</button> <textarea :...
textarea下划线 设置一张1*35//行高的图片 , 设置背景图即可. background: url('./img/linebg.png') repeat; border: none;outline: none;overflow: hidden; line-height: 35px;//注意行高要和背景图高度一致resize: none; 固定输入行数 需求:用户固定不论多少字节,只能输入2行. ...